The application of the electronic and the X-ray photoelectric spectroscopy (XPS) for the examination of the passivization film on the tinplate

The structure of passivization film has an important role in the adhesion of lacquer on the tinplate, and also in further behavior of the can filled with a different content. It is for this reason that the composition of passivization film and its influence on lacquering and adhesion were examined in this work. The composition of passivization film on the tinplate was examined after storage by the application of the AUGER spectroscopy (AES) and by the X-ray photoelectric spectroscopy (ESCA). The results show that the tinplates stored during three years have surface composition and capability of adhesion acceptable for use in food industry. .
